As Pakistan undergoes massive infrastructure modernization propelled by the China-Pakistan Economic Corridor (CPEC), traditional manual low-density warehousing is rapidly shifting towards modern, high-density distribution centers. Hubs like the Gwadar Free Zone, Port Qasim in Karachi, and the dry ports of Lahore, Sialkot, and Faisalabad require structural steel pallet systems that optimize overhead vertical volume safely.
With real estate costs rising, companies are looking for reliable pallet racking suppliers who can design systems with seismic resilience. Northern Pakistan, particularly around Rawalpindi and Peshawar, lies on active tectonic fault lines. Racking installations in these areas must utilize specialized baseplates, oversized seismic anchor bolts, and specific cross-bracing ratios to handle dynamic shifts without structural failure.

Coastal storage hubs, particularly in Karachi and nearby industrial zones like Korangi and Landhi, face severe environmental stress due to relative humidity levels exceeding 80% and high saline content in the air. Under these conditions, sub-standard steel and low-grade paint coatings degrade rapidly, leading to oxidation, rust, and catastrophic load failure.

| Racking Architecture Type | Typical Load Capacities | Suitable Forklift Types | Key Operational Advantages | Typical Applications |
|---|---|---|---|---|
| Selective Pallet Racking | 1,000kg - 3,000kg per level | Reach Trucks, Counterbalance | 100% SKU selectivity, low initial cost, easy configuration | FMCG, general retail, 3PL logistics, textile warehouses |
| Double Deep Racking | 1,000kg - 2,500kg per level | Pantograph Reach Trucks | Reduces aisle count, increases storage density by 30% | Cold storage, high volume/low SKU manufacturing |
| Drive-In / Drive-Through | 1,000kg - 2,000kg per pallet | Standard Counterbalance | Maximum bulk density, utilizes up to 85% available floor space | Seasonal products, agricultural depots, temperature-controlled facilities |
| Very Narrow Aisle (VNA) | 1,000kg - 1,500kg per level | VNA Man-up/Man-down Trucks | High density vertical storage combined with 100% selectivity | E-commerce fulfillment centers, pharmaceuticals, electronics |
| Radio Shuttle System | 1,500kg - 2,500kg per pallet | Semi-automated Shuttle Cart | Minimal forklift travel inside racks, high throughput efficiency | Food & Beverage, cold chain logistics, high volume production |

Faisalabad's textile hub requires massive fabric roll handling capacity. We design extra-deep selective structures equipped with industrial wire decking or customized support bars to accommodate bulk woven rolls and non-standard pallets without sagging.
Karachi's high-velocity maritime import/export terminals require highly flexible selective systems. We deliver systems with easily adjustable 50mm pitch beam heights, heavy-duty row spacers, and thick frame protectors to withstand high-volume round-the-clock operations.
Drive-In systems are optimized for sub-zero food and dairy storage in Punjab. Minimizing the aisle area cuts heat loss and operating costs, while our galvanized frame components resist ambient humidity degradation.

Our heavy-duty racking systems are manufactured using Q235B cold-rolled structural steel, which matches the mechanical properties of ASTM A36. Q235B is recognized for its structural yield strength and weldability, making it ideal for multi-tier industrial racking. For seismic installations, we can also provide Q345B steel to deliver higher load capacity under extreme shear stress.
Our engineering team designs projects according to SEMA standards and building code requirements. For earthquake-prone areas like Rawalpindi, Quetta, and Peshawar, we configure frames with custom baseplates that distribute vertical loads over a larger slab area, thick seismic floor anchors, and cross-bracing systems to handle high horizontal forces.
We provide two advanced corrosion prevention solutions. For standard dry warehouses, we apply a multi-stage pickling treatment followed by an electrostatic powder coating with a dry film thickness of 70-110 microns. For high-corrosion environments like open docks or cold storage facilities, we offer hot-dip galvanized steel components with long-term salt spray resistance.
